Power Ge'ez 2009 is a legacy Windows-based software suite developed by Concepts Data Systems PLC
. It is designed to enable users to type and display the Ethiopic (Ge'ez) script for languages such as Amharic, Tigrinya, and Tigre across standard PC applications. Core Functionality System-Wide Input:
Allows users to type in Ethiopic script in virtually any Windows program, including Microsoft Office, email clients, and web browsers. Font Support: Includes both Unicode-compliant fonts for modern web/screen display and legacy non-Unicode fonts for older documents. Keyboard Layouts:
Offers phonetic and mnemonic layouts that map Ethiopic characters to English (Latin) keys, making it intuitive for those familiar with the sounds of the language. Key Features Advanced Font Converter:
Includes a "Power Converter" utility capable of translating over 27 different types of fonts from other Ethiopic software (e.g., Agafari, Visual Ge'ez, NCI) into Power Ge'ez format. Automatic Font Recognition:
Features an "Enable/Disable" setting to automatically detect the appropriate fonts for display. Dual Modes:
Provides a "normal phonetic mode" (requiring specific Ge'ez fonts) and a "phonetic UNICODE mode" for standard web-compliant text. Search and Sort:
Supports sorting and searching features specifically designed for Ge'ez script characters. Compatibility and Requirements Operating Systems:
Originally designed for Windows 95, 98, 2000, NT, XP, and Vista. While older, it has been noted by some users to function on later versions like Windows 10 through specific installation steps. Productivity Suites:
Compatible with Microsoft Office versions ranging from 97 to 2003, as well as newer versions supporting standard Windows word processing. Executables: The software suite typically includes files such as pg2009.exe pgConverter.exe pgCalendar.exe Availability

The software operates in two primary modes to accommodate different document needs:
Phonetic Mode: Requires selecting specific Ge'ez fonts (typically labeled Ge'ez 1-3). This is often used for legacy document maintenance.
Phonetic UNICODE Mode: Uses standard Unicode fonts (like Nyala). This is recommended for web content and emails to ensure the recipient can read the text without needing your specific software.
Language Switching: You can typically toggle between English and Ethiopic input using a hotkey or the taskbar icon. Modern Alternatives

Power Ge'ez 2009 for PC: A Complete Overview Power Ge'ez 2009 is a comprehensive Amharic word-processing software suite developed by Concepts Data Systems PLC
. It is specifically designed to enable users to type, display, and manage Ethiopic (Ge'ez) script across various Windows-based applications, including Microsoft Office , web browsers, and email clients Key Features and Functionalities System-Wide Integration
: Allows for Ethiopic script input across virtually all Windows applications. Unicode Support
: Includes Unicode-compliant fonts, ensuring accurate on-screen display and high-quality printing. Font Recognition and Conversion
: Features automatic font recognition and can convert documents written in over 27 different types of legacy Ethiopic fonts (such as Agafari, Feedel, and NCI) into modern formats. Dual Typing Modes Phonetic Mode
: Designed for users unfamiliar with traditional layouts; it uses a combination of consonants and vowels based on English sounds (e.g., typing "kwa" to produce the corresponding Ge'ez character). Typewriter Mode
: Emulates the conventional Amharic typewriter layout for experienced users. Multilingual Support
: Supports major Ethiopian and Eritrean languages using the Ge'ez script, such as Amharic, Tigrinya, and Tigre. System Requirements and Compatibility Power Ge’ez 2009 remains a reliable choice for
Power Ge'ez 2009 was originally designed for older Windows environments but maintains a level of utility in modern setups: Operating Systems
: Proven compatibility with Windows 95, 98, NT, Me, 2000, XP, and Vista. While not natively designed for modern systems, users often install it on Windows 10 and 11 using specific setup procedures or Community Guides Software Compatibility
: Designed to work with Microsoft Office versions 97 through 2003 and later. Installation and Usage Tips Preparation
: Before installation, close all running programs. Ensure the installation medium (CD or digital setup) is available. Microsoft Word Settings
: To prevent character display errors, MS Word users should disable AutoCorrect Automatic Format
features (specifically "Straight quotes with smart quotes"). Keyboard Layout : Ensure your PC's system keyboard language is set to English (United States) to avoid layout conflicts. System Tray Icon
: Upon startup, the software places an icon in the taskbar. This icon allows you to quickly toggle between English and Phonetic modes or access the main settings menu. Modern Alternatives
